It’s no secret that Huawei is gearing up to launch a new flagship in March – and the latest leaks suggest it’s going to be called the Huwaei P20. Here’s everything we’ve heard about the handset, including its release date, specs, features and price.
WinFuture’s Roland Quandt took to Twitter on January 27 to reveal that Huawei is working on a trio of new smartphones: the Huawei P20, Huawei P20 Lite and Huawei P20 Plus – with the former set to headline the range as the firm’s much-anticipated flagship smartphone of 2018.
Huawei P20 family – codenames and colors
Huawei P20 – "Emily" – Ceramic Black / Twilight
Huawei P20 Plus – "Charlotte" – Ceramic Black / Twilight
Huawei P20 Lite – "Anne" – Midnight Black / Klein Blue / Sakura Pink— Roland Quandt (@rquandt) January 27, 2018
Quandt also cast a light on the various colour options the handsets will ship in. The Huawei P20 and Huawei P20 Plus will be available in Ceramic Black and Twilight, while the more affordable Huawei P20 Lite will come in Klein Blue, Midnight Black and Sakura Pink, apparently.
Huawei P20 Design and Specs: What does it look like, and is it a beast?
The Huawei P20, Huawei P20 Lite and Huawei P20 Plus all broke cover in a drop shared on leak aggregator SlashLeaks on February 5 – with the former and latter touting a triple-lens camera equipped with a dual-LED flash, and the middle a dual-lens shooter.

Little is known about the specifics of the Huawei P20 Lite and Huawei P20 Plus. A recent leaked promotional poster, however, points towards the flagship Huawei P20 shipping with a 40-megapixel triple-lens camera setup, complete with a five-times hybrid zoom and a 24-megapixel selfie shooter.

The handset, which was once believed to be branded the Huawei P11, is also tipped to feature a 5.8-inch IPS ultra-tall screen (1440 x 2960 pixels), a 3GHz Kirin 970 octa-core processor, at least 6GB of RAM, 64GB of expandable internal storage and a 3,200mAh non-removable battery.
Huawei P20 Price and Release Date: When does it come out, and how much will it cost?
Bruce Lee, Huawei’s VP of Smartphones, revealed back in 2017 that Huawei will “probably” launch all future flagships at Mobile World Congress, leading many to believe that it will showcase the oft-rumoured Huawei P20 at MWC 2018 in Barcelona at the end of February.

But it would appear that isn’t going to be the case as the firm has since sent out invitations to a standalone event it’s holding in Paris, France on March 27, where it’s expected to announce not only the flagship Huawei P20, but also the Huawei P20 Lite and Huawei P20 Plus.

There’s no word on pricing for the Huawei P20, let alone the Huawei P20 Lite and Huawei P20 Plus, just yet. That said, if the flagship adheres to the same pricing scheme as its predecessor, the Huawei P10, it should be priced somewhere in the region of £550 ($650) to £650 ($750).
